Expeditions: Rome

Expeditions: Rome

The future of Rome is in your hands: what will your legacy be?

Take on the role of a young Legatus whose father was murdered by an unknown political opponent, forcing you to escape Rome and take refuge in the military campaign to subdue a Greek rebellion. Step by step, you increase your military prowess, strengthen yourself in the forge of combat, and become the Legatus everyone learns to both respect, and to fear.

In Expeditions: Rome, you exert the will of Rome through your actions across the world stage, from the bright blue coasts of Greece to the deep forests of Gaul. Decide how people will view you, and Rome. Will you strike with an iron fist, or speak with a silver tongue? Will you embrace the political heritage of the Republic, or carve your own path as you navigate the complex politics of the Roman Senate? Every choice matters as you decide the fate of your legion, your close companions, and of Rome itself.

  • Create your own Roman Legatus! Customize your character’s look, gender, class, and skills to match your playstyle and role-playing fantasy

  • Engage in tactical turn-based combat powered by an extensive skill-based action system where every weapon changes your potency on the battlefield

  • Adventure with 5 unique companions discovering their extensive backstories and unique personalities

  • Explore a beautifully realized, colorful world across many different environments, including North Africa, Greece, Gaul, and Rome herself

  • Experience a historically inspired story of political intrigue and personal drama through a fully voiced narrative where choices matter and consequences are far-reaching

  • Level-up each character and select from a variety of skills and passive abilities to explore a wide range of tactical options

  • Loot, Craft, and Equip a variety of weapons, armors, and tactical items to customize your game even further, providing a tremendous range of tactical options for each character

  • Lead your legion on 3 extensive war campaigns across Greece, North Africa, and Gaul. Recruit legionaries, improve your warcamp, conquer regions, exploit resources, and defend your territories as you lead your legion to victory

Miasma 2: Freedom Uprising

Miasma 2: Freedom Uprising

Miasma 2, the sequel to the Xbox Live Indie strategy game, was released in 2012 in the “Indie Games” category and on PC. It’s now been rebuilt for modern processors and made available on Steam with support for Cloud Saves, Achievements and Steam Leaderboards. It is presented here, like the original, as a glimpse into XBLIG development at the time.

Original (2012) description:

ESP Games present Miasma 2, the sequel to 2010’s turn-based strategy hit.

Take control of Paul or Lina once more, and command your elite squad of freedom fighters in battle against the oppressive Vilhelm Industries. With an all-new turn-based tactics/real-time battle system, the action runs fast and thick, and with new units to command - and a whole new graphics engine - this is one adventure not to be missed.

Everblood Arena

Everblood Arena

Everblood Arena is a turn-based roguelite tactics arena battler with a heavy focus on procedural generated items and character builds. Get your team of fantasy warriors and take part in 5v5 tactical turn based battles. Rise your way up the ranks and claim the greatest prize, the Everblood Cup!

item randomization

Item randomization is a huge part of Everblood’s design philosophy. A huge array of spells & modifiers exist and items through a myriad of algorithms will mix and match these so that each piece of gear comes with it’s own skill tree & modifiers. Make tactical choices between leveling up your character’s Strength, or leveling up his Fiery Sword of the Helmsplitter to unlock it’s epic quality rank 3 spell.

This doesn’t just stop at items though! Character’s will also be randomly generated, with a small variety of races, each containing their own smaller skill tree’s with lots of attribute randomization.

Our hope is that this focus on randomization and creating a rogue-lite atmosphere will add lots of replay-ability and create dynamically changing character builds.

a Roguelite?

We intend to add roguelite elements to Everblood, with characters sustaining meaningful injuries (and potential death!) from getting knocked out in combat, we expect players to have to recruit new hero’s as theirs die, slowly adapting their tactics and equipment to fit the strength’s of their randomly generated character team. Our hope is that each run of Everblood will be a multi-hour affair, with difficulty changing drastically based on your starting roster & the generated teams you come up against

Misunderstood by new players. Yes, you can “speed up” the starring of your epic heroes with money. However, there are equalizing heroes at the common and uncommon range that level the playing field with strategy and knowledge of the game. New players just get pounded in because they can’t be bothered to figure it out. Knowing which common and uncommon heroes to invest in as a f2p player (buying stones up to 5k gold on the shop every day) in conjunction with knowing which SuperRare/Epic heroes you want to funnel stones into (tower/missions-never waste on a common/uncommon hero even if they are preferred) is what makes a player. Is it possible for somoene to spend thousands of dollars to star up a tough epic hero? Absolutely. We called those guys a “JimRen” when I was dinging up as a f2p having to vs him. He was the iconic p2w and he never did any pve content, leveling as slowly as possible by beating up on f2p players in pvp and nothing else. One of the best moments in the game for me was when I used 4-5* common heroes in the 46~ range to beat his 7* epic and SR heroes. Literal thousands of dollars spent, defeated by some game knowledge and strategy. Don’t whine about p2w when you don’t understand the game.
